A novel, simple, and efficient sample preparation method was developed for microextraction of benzene, toluene, ethylbenzene, and xylene (BTEX) from water samples before gas chromatographic analysis. Separation and preconcentration is based on the dispersion of olive oil microdrops as an extraction solvent. The influence of microextraction conditions such as type and volume of oil and back extraction solvent, ionic strength, extraction temperature, and extraction time were evaluated. Under optimal conditions, the enrichment factors, dynamic linear ranges, limits of detection, and precision of the method were studied. The proposed method was successfully applied for BTEX determination from water samples by GC-FID.
